About P. N. Alboni

P. N. Alboni is a scholar working on Materials Chemistry, Condensed Matter Physics,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ials, Mechanical Engineering and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, having authored 14 papers that have together received 391 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Advanced Thermoelectric Materials and Devices (10 papers), Thermal properties of materials (6 papers), Thermal Expansion and Ionic Conductivity (3 papers), Intermetallics and Advanced Alloy Properties (3 papers), Thermodynamic and Structural Properties of Metals and Alloys (2 papers), Quasicrystal Structures and Properties (2 papers), Rare-earth and actinide compounds (2 papers) and Chalcogenide Semiconductor Thin Films (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Materials Chemistry (377 citations), Condensed Matter Physics (76 citations),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ials (90 citations), Civil and Structural Engineering (70 citations) and Nuclear Energy and Engineering (1 citation). P. N. Alboni has collaborated with scholars based in United States, China and Canada. Frequent co-authors include Terry M. Tritt, Jian He, N. Gothard, Jiangying Peng, Xing Ji, Zhe Su, George S. Nolas, Jihui Yang, Joshua Martin and V. Ponnambalam.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Applied Physics, Journal of Electronic Materials, Journal of Alloys and Compounds, physica status solidi (RRL) - Rapid Research Letters and MRS Proceedings.
